Output 24fa61b2ea44cd7cdcb8e7c67a5e0579725ee532c26c6c1f8c4f817cc8d3784b:3

value
23871589
script pubkey
OP_0 OP_PUSHBYTES_20 c7533603e9e3530a64bced8e30e06481cdedfcc9
address
bc1qcafnvqlfudfs5e9uak8rpcrys8x7mlxfsj8qh0
transaction
24fa61b2ea44cd7cdcb8e7c67a5e0579725ee532c26c6c1f8c4f817cc8d3784b